Don Smith <dhs...@bellsouth.net> was very recently heard to utter:

> I worked for three hours then Publsher crashed. I had saved my file,
> but when I trie to open it it says problem with file, do you want to
> report it, and then reboots Publisher. How can I save my work?

Start > Run
Type "%temp%" without the quotes
Click OK

Look for files named pub*.tmp (* is a wildcard).

Copy them to your desktop, rename them to .pub files, and try opening them
in Publisher.

Fingers crossed one of them will be an earlier version of your file.
